About
Fernworthy Reservoir is a reservoir in Devon, South-West England, supplying water and increasingly opened up for sailing, walking and birdwatching. The site is a designated Site of Special Scientific Interest. It sits within the Central Devon parliamentary constituency. Postcode area TQ13.
